Output 264a558e526632537ce63bcd39c793253fbebe3c044d85fe7233bbba8d0d7207:1

value
24685811
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 18c799bdbe2053a5a99bf1a6867739001fa8b56d OP_EQUALVERIFY OP_CHECKSIG
address
LMUybJixQR5zcSqtuMoUDnpygvgiH62hAH
transaction
264a558e526632537ce63bcd39c793253fbebe3c044d85fe7233bbba8d0d7207
spent
true